Man, 35, Who Steals & Sells Children Each For N80,000 Arrested
CYRIACUS IZUEKWE
A 35-year old man, Sunday Alani, who specialised in stealing and selling children to women for N80,000 each, has finally been arrested by the Police operatives from the Ogun State Command.
P.M.EXPRESS reports that the Police operatives arrested the suspect, Alani, on 23rd February, 2022, for stealing a one-year old child at Atolashe Village in Odeda Local Government Area of the state.
He is presently undergoing interrogation and has made some confessional statements how he has being stealing children and selling them to his buyers.
This was confirmed by the Command’s spokesperson, DSP Abimbola Oyeyemi, in Abeokuta in Ogun State.
He stated that the suspect, Alani, was arrested following a distress call received by the Policemen attached to Odeda Divisional Headquarters that while the little girl was playing around in her parent’s compound, the suspect took advantage of the inattentive of her mother, who was busy frying (garri) cassava flakes as he stylishly took the little girl and started running away.
“It was a passerby, who noticed the suspicious movement of the suspect that called the attention of the mother who then raised alarm.”
“Upon the distress call, the DPO Odeda Division, CSP Femi Olabode, quickly mobilized his men in conjunction with so safe corps men and moved to the scene.
“The suspect was chased to the bush, where he was arrested and the child rescued from him.”
“On interrogation, the suspect confessed to the crime, he informed the Police that he came to the area with two women, who are his accomplices.”
“He explained further that he had previously stolen two children from Egbeda in Lagos and Akute area of Ogun state.
According to him, once he succeeded in stealing a child, he will hand such child to the two women, who will give him the sum of eighty thousand Naira.
Meanwhile, the Ogun State Commissioner of Police, CP Lanre Bankole, has ordered manhunt for the two women accomplices of the suspect with the view to bring them to justice.
The CP also directed that the suspect be transferred to the State Criminal Investigation and Intelligence Department for discreet investigation.
